Abstract
Ankle osteoarthritis (OA) is a progressive degenerative joint disease characterized by cartilage deterioration, joint space narrowing, and functional impairment. Although non-surgical treatments are first-line therapies, surgical intervention often may become necessary in case of advanced degeneration and persistent symptoms. This chapter provides an overview of the fundamental surgical techniques utilized in the management of ankle joint osteoarthritis, including indications, surgical approach, and expected outcomes.
